- INTRODUCTION: Limb Girdle Muscular Dystrophy Type 2C (LGMD-2C) is caused by mutations in ɤ-sarcoglycan and is a devastating, progressive, and fully lethal human muscle wasting disease that is without effective treatment. - … After we discovered that dystrophin is located on the cell membrane in 1988, we studied the architecture of dystrophin and dystrophin-associated proteins (DAPs) complex in order to investigate the function of dystrophin and pathomechanism of DMD. … During the conduct of these studies, we came to consider that the dystrophin–DAP complex serves to transmembranously connect the subsarcolemmal cytoskeleton networks and basal lamina to protect the lipid bilayer. …

- … Genetic depletion of the dystrophin-related glycoprotein (DRGP) complex causes cardiomyopathy in animals and humans. … The levels of α- and β-sarcoglycan and β-dystroglycan in the right ventricle of the MCT rats at the 6th and 8th weeks were markedly decreased, and these decreases were inversely related to the increase in the right ventricular Tei index of the MCT-administered animals. …
